【Voice &APP &Remote Control】 Ceiling fan with lights and remote control(handheld and wall mounted), still in control when WiFi doesn’t work.

Smart ceiling fan works with Alexa, Google and App, you can control via “Alexa/Google, turn on bedroom smart ceiling fan” or App from anywhere.

【Bright Dimmable LED Lights】 Ceiling fan with color-changing light (3000K warm yellow light, 4000K bright daylight, 6000K cool white light), dimmable from 0%-100%, create desired atmosphere for working, leisure, party.

Bright 2000 lumen ceiling fan light with better eye protection, longer lifespan.

【Quiet Powerful DC Motor】 6-speeds modern farmhouse ceiling fan delivers powerful airflow up to 7049 CFM.

High CFM quiet dc ceiling fan with light keep room cool with noise under 30dB, no hum and no wobble.

Reverse allows summer downdraft mode and winter updraft mode.

【Indoor Outdoor Dual Mount】 Damp-rated black smart ceiling fan suitable for indoor and covered outdoor areas.

Smart outdoor ceiling fans for patios, porch, gazebo.

Height adjustable with short 4” rod and long 10” rod, for low/high profile, flush/slanted mounting.

【Modern Farmhouse 2-in-1 Blades】 52 Inch matte black ceiling fan with lights and remote control, with dark walnut and light walnut blades options, looks between farmhouse and modern style.

With auto-on/off Timer, smart lighting & ceiling fans help to set your daily routine.

    I have two of these fans and planned on getting three more once our house is complete. I’m waiting a bit before I purchase the rest to see other available options. The first two are in the living room and dining room. As others have said about the installation, the controller is a pain to get into the fan mount. There’s no clearance Clarence. Beyond that, and the 5 short ground wires, the fan is good. It runs quiet and wasn’t too difficult to balance.I’m building a smart dome home, and these fans do work with Alexa, but not easily. To turn on the living room fan I can say, ” Alexa, turn on the living room fan”. The fan will come on. I can turn off both fans by saying, “Alexa, turn off the fans” and both will turn off. I assume this command will work with all future fans.Turning on the lights is the biggest issue. I need to say, “Alexa, turn on the light on the living room fan”. You need to be clear that you say, “on the living room fan” (or whatever you name it) or she will confirm and not turn on the light. While this specific command does turn on the light, it also turns on the fan, so I’d have tell Alexa to turn off the fan afterwards. It has become easier to use the app to turn on the light since I don’t use the remote because I don’t need another remote in my house. I would have liked a brighter maximum option for the light but it is enough to illuminate an average sized room.The wind breeze option is great. We live on a tropical island with trade winds and these fans do create a breeze similar to the outside breeze.

    The fan works well and my electrician easily installed it. The DC motor is very quiet and it remembers both the light and fan settings when the fan is turned off and on with a wall switch. The Smart Life App allows full control of the fan and light. The only negative is the poor integration with Alexa. You cannot turn on the light without the fan coming on through Alexa. This is the case with the Alexa App and with voice control.
